1. Can all video games improve hand-eye coordination?
Not all games are created equal, but action games and those requiring fast reflexes tend to yield the best results in improving hand-eye coordination.
2. How often should I play video games to benefit?
Moderation is key! Even 30 minutes a few times a week can help enhance motor skills and coordination effectively.
3. Are there age restrictions on video games for skill development?
No! Players of all ages can benefit from gaming, with age-appropriate games tailored for younger players.

Hand-eye coordination (HEC) refers to the ability to synchronize visual input with motor actions. Picture a basketball player shooting a three-pointer—they rely on excellent HEC to score! 🏀 Not only is it essential for sports, but this skill also translates into everyday tasks like typing, driving, or even cooking. Statistically, people with strong hand-eye coordination often outperform others in various fields, from surgeons wielding scalpels to musicians hitting the right notes. 🎶
Engaging in video games requires players to process visual information quickly while making precise movements. The brain and hand work together in a synchronized dance that can amplify hand-eye coordination in real-world applications. Studies have shown that action game players often demonstrate significantly better HEC skills than non-gamers. A notable research from the University of Utah indicated a whopping 50% improvement in tasks requiring swift eye movement among regular gamers! 📊
Research by cognitive neuroscientists like Dr. Daphne Bavelier reveals that playing fast-paced video games enhances the brain’s ability to process visual stimuli, leading to improved hand-eye coordination. 🧠 In one study, gamers developed a sharper sense of spatial awareness, akin to a pilot navigating through clouds. The gaming experience conditioned their brains to react swiftly to changing environments.
